TL;DR

European countries are actively procuring alternatives to Palantir for military and intelligence data analysis, with contracts awarded and testing underway. This marks a significant shift toward sovereign capabilities and reduced dependence on US vendors.

European governments are increasingly moving away from Palantir for their military and intelligence data analysis needs, with recent contracts awarded to domestic and alternative vendors, signaling a shift toward sovereignty and operational independence.

In May 2026, Germany’s domestic intelligence agency, the BfV, awarded a large-scale data-analysis contract to France’s ChapsVision, explicitly choosing it over Palantir, which has historically sought to dominate the European security market. The Dutch defense ministry announced in early June a two-year plan to develop a fully sovereign alternative to Palantir’s systems, citing concerns over data security and political dependence. Additionally, the UK parliamentary committee criticized reliance on Palantir, describing it as an ‘unacceptable weakness’ and urging a review of existing contracts, including a £330 million deal with the NHS.

France is testing Arcadia, a NATO-interoperable battlefield AI system built on previous work like Artemis/Athea, as a sovereign counter to Palantir’s Maven. Meanwhile, other European contenders such as Helsing in Germany, Systematic in Denmark, and Italy’s Octostar are making strides, with some securing contracts and others preparing for testing phases. Ukraine’s DELTA system continues to demonstrate that non-US, non-Palantir solutions can operate effectively under extreme conditions.

The current landscape reflects a clear shift: while Palantir remains mature and combat-proven, European governments are prioritizing sovereignty, security, and operational control, leading to active procurement and testing of alternatives. The trend indicates a move toward consolidating a European supply chain for intelligence and battlefield systems, with multiple contenders vying for a slice of the emerging market.

STEELMAN: WHY PALANTIR KEEPS WINNING ANYWAY

Mature, integrated, combat-proven at alliance scale — and switching costs in intelligence tooling are brutal. No European contender today offers the full bundle; several governments funding alternatives still run Palantir somewhere in the stack. The Dutch two-year timeline exists precisely because rip-and-replace carries real operational risk.

The signal: named contracts, named deadlines, named systems under test — demand has moved from sentiment to procurement. Supply is credible but fragmented; expect consolidation and consortiums, because buyers now want the bundle without the flag. Decided in the next 24 months.

European Efforts to Achieve Data Sovereignty in Defense

Over the past two years, European governments have increasingly scrutinized their reliance on US technology providers for critical defense and intelligence functions. The adoption of Palantir’s Maven system by NATO in March 2025 marked a significant milestone, but its deployment and subsequent publicized use in operations against Iran in March 2026 caused discomfort among European allies concerned about sovereignty and control. This has prompted a wave of procurement efforts, testing, and development of domestic systems, including France’s Arcadia, Germany’s Helsing, and Denmark’s SitaWare, aimed at reducing dependency on foreign vendors and fostering sovereign capabilities.

While Palantir’s products are mature and combat-proven, the high switching costs and operational risks associated with migration have underscored the importance of developing indigenous solutions. Several European nations still utilize Palantir systems but are funding alternative projects to build a more autonomous ecosystem for intelligence and battlefield management.

Key Questions

Why are European countries moving away from Palantir?

European countries are concerned about data sovereignty, political dependence, and operational security, prompting them to seek indigenous or alternative systems that they control and can adapt to their specific needs.

Are European alternatives ready to replace Palantir?

While several contenders are making significant progress, none currently match Palantir’s breadth and maturity. The next two years will be critical to see if they can develop fully operational, combat-ready systems.

What risks are involved in switching from Palantir?

The main risks include operational disruption, high migration costs, and potential gaps in capabilities during the transition period. Palantir’s mature ecosystem and integration make switching complex and costly.

How will this shift affect transatlantic intelligence cooperation?

Reducing dependence on US vendors could lead to more autonomous European capabilities but may also complicate existing partnerships unless interoperability is maintained through NATO and joint standards.
